Sakya Tsechen Thubten Ling is a Dharma centre where anybody interested can learn meditation, Buddhist philosophy and practices. Conveniently located in Richmond, BC, Canada, and easily acceesible by public transit, we host regular in person as well as ZOOM classes and practice, and invite esteemed teachers and scholars to teach at our centre from time to time.
Join us on Sunday mornings at 10:00AM to practise Green Tara puja led by Lama Ngawang Tenzin.